>>75795923
In Greece there was a housing boom in the 70s.

The government defines 2 types of city borders, say A and B. You can build multistorey buildings in A, and lower, more scarce buildings in area B. You can't build shit in other areas.

So you get the typical Greek town with a heavily populated core, a "suburb" with sparser 1-2 story houses and then agricultural fields.

All buildings are reinforced concrete and mansonry due to strict earthquake guidelines, that's one thing that's actually enforced in Greece.

>>75795923
It really depends on the city. It varies between full-scale reconstructions of old buildings where they meticulously cataloged every little piece of bombed rubble of the former building, shitty brutalist/commie block architecture and modern/glassy internationalist skyscrapers. In general the former roadmap was kept intact. So you have urban centers with pedestrian zones around the market/church square. Public transport is good in general.
